I have an A6-3400M originally clocked at 1.4 with a turbo to 2.3. These O/C so great and are so overvolted out of the factory that I had no problem reaching 2.3 stable with a 1.1v

Point being, I would like to know opinions on running APUs just under the max temp. I have heard that keeping it 5c below the max temp during gaming and for a few hours is ok. @2.3 I reach about 80-85c during gaming (Max being 100c) and during prime95 it gets to about 94c. So, my question stands as "How much life am I losing by running at these O/Cd temps, and what are opinions regarding such?"

Yes, I've read forums about these chips and have read a lot about O/C in general. Just wanted a general consensus about high temps and the life you lose from your machine.

Personally I'd be a little uncomfortable if it was constantly in the 80's but that's just my preference. Just don't run prime95 too often.

Also if it's in a laptop I'd be careful as dust tends to build up in the fan exhaust vents which will eventually form a thick enough layer that even though you can't see it from the outside, will be enough to overheat the inside of your laptop.

Hopefully it should shut down before doing any damage, just keep monitoring the temps.
